contentstyle(easyexcel2.2.10api)
EasyExcel是一个开源的Java库,用于在Excel文件中读取和写入数据。它提供了简单易用的API,使开发人员能够轻松地操作Excel文件,包括创建、读取、修改和删除工作表、单元格以及其他Excel对象。
在EasyExcel 2.2.10版本中,引入了contentstyle(easyexcel2.2.10api)的功能。这个功能主要用于设置单元格的样式,包括字体、颜色、边框、对齐方式等。通过使用contentstyle(easyexcel2.2.10api),开发人员可以根据自己的需求,自定义Excel文件中单元格的外观。
在使用contentstyle(easyexcel2.2.10api)时,首先需要创建一个样式对象,然后通过设置样式对象的属性来定义单元格的样式。例如,可以设置字体的大小、颜色和粗细,设置单元格的背景色,设置边框的样式和颜色,以及设置文本的对齐方式等。
下面是一个使用contentstyle(easyexcel2.2.10api)设置单元格样式的示例代码:
// 创建样式对象
CellStyle style = workbook.createCellStyle();
// 设置字体样式
Font font = workbook.createFont();
font.setFontName("Arial");
font.setFontHeightInPoints((short) 12);
font.setBold(true);
style.setFont(font);
// 设置背景色
style.setFillForegroundColor(IndexedColors.YELLOW.getIndex());
style.setFillPattern(FillPatternType.SOLID_FOREGROUND);
// 设置边框样式和颜色
style.setBorderBottom(BorderStyle.THIN);
style.setBottomBorderColor(IndexedColors.BLACK.getIndex());
style.setBorderLeft(BorderStyle.THIN);
style.setLeftBorderColor(IndexedColors.BLACK.getIndex());
style.setBorderRight(BorderStyle.THIN);
style.setRightBorderColor(IndexedColors.BLACK.getIndex());
style.setBorderTop(BorderStyle.THIN);
style.setTopBorderColor(IndexedColors.BLACK.getIndex());
// 设置文本对齐方式
style.setAlignment(HorizontalAlignment.CENTER);
style.setVerticalAlignment(VerticalAlignment.CENTER);
// 应用样式到单元格
cell.setCellStyle(style);
通过上述代码,可以看到如何使用contentstyle(easyexcel2.2.10api)来设置单元格的样式。开发人员可以根据自己的需求,灵活地设置各种样式属性,以满足不同的显示要求。
总结一下,contentstyle(easyexcel2.2.10api)是EasyExcel库中的一个功能,用于设置Excel文件中单元格的样式。通过使用这个功能,开发人员可以自定义单元格的外观,包括字体、颜色、边框、对齐方式等。这个功能使得操作Excel文件更加灵活和方便,能够满足不同的需求。
千锋教育拥有多年IT培训服务经验,提供Java培训、web前端培训、大数据培训,python培训等课程,采用全程面授高品质、高体验培养模式,拥有国内一体化教学管理及学员服务,想获取更多IT技术干货请登录千锋教育IT培训机构官网。